让老Mac重获新生:OpenCore Legacy Patcher全方位使用指南
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
设备兼容性速查
| 设备类型 | 支持年份 | 推荐系统版本 | 核心优化点 |
|---|---|---|---|
| MacBook Pro | 2012-2017 | macOS Monterey | 显卡驱动/电池管理 |
| MacBook Air | 2013-2017 | macOS Ventura | 续航优化/性能调校 |
| iMac | 2012-2019 | macOS Sonoma | 图形加速/外部显示 |
| Mac mini | 2012-2018 | macOS Big Sur | 内存管理/USB兼容性 |
⚠️ 注意:2011年前设备可能存在部分功能限制,建议先查阅官方支持列表 docs/MODELS.md
一、痛点诊断:老设备的"退休危机"
1.1 系统升级受阻的常见表现
- App Store提示"此更新不适用于您的Mac"
- 硬件配置满足但无法安装最新系统
- 官方支持周期结束后安全更新中断
1.2 性能衰减的幕后真因
通俗类比:就像旧手机升级新系统后变得卡顿,老Mac的硬件驱动与新系统存在"代沟"
专业注释:新macOS版本对硬件指令集和驱动架构有更新要求,旧设备缺乏原生支持
二、工具解析:OpenCore Legacy Patcher原理
2.1 核心功能速览
- [构建引导环境]→[突破系统安装限制]
- [制作启动盘]→[绕开官方验证机制]
- [根补丁]→[修复系统底层驱动的工具包]
2.2 工作流程图解
三、实施指南:四步完成系统升级
3.1 环境准备清单
- ✅ 16GB以上U盘(将被格式化)
- ✅ 稳定网络连接(下载系统需要约10GB流量)
- ✅ 数据备份(推荐使用Time Machine)
3.2 构建引导环境
操作步骤:
- 运行OpenCore Legacy Patcher
- 选择"Build and Install OpenCore"
- 等待自动配置完成
- 点击"Install to disk"确认安装
⚠️ 新手误区:不要手动修改配置文件,工具会根据硬件自动优化设置
3.3 制作启动U盘
关键提示:
- 选择正确的U盘设备(注意容量和名称)
- 格式化过程会清除所有数据
- 制作完成后会显示验证成功提示
3.4 应用根补丁
操作要点:
- 系统安装后重新运行工具
- 选择"Post-Install Root Patch"
- 勾选需要修复的硬件模块
- 重启后完成驱动适配
四、优化策略:让老设备焕发第二春
4.1 性能调校建议
- 禁用SIP(系统完整性保护)提升补丁效果
- 调整显存分配改善图形性能
- 关闭不必要的视觉效果减少资源占用
4.2 电池续航优化
✅ 成功案例:2015款MacBook Pro升级后续航提升25%
优化方案:
- 启用低功耗模式
- 调整显示器亮度自动调节
- 关闭后台刷新进程
五、进阶探索:深入理解开源方案
5.1 源码结构解析
核心模块位置:
- 硬件检测:opencore_legacy_patcher/detections/
- 系统补丁:opencore_legacy_patcher/sys_patch/
- 用户界面:opencore_legacy_patcher/wx_gui/
5.2 自定义配置指南
高级用户可修改以下文件实现个性化设置:
- 驱动配置:payloads/Config/config.plist
- 硬件适配:opencore_legacy_patcher/datasets/model_array.py
通过OpenCore Legacy Patcher,你的老款Mac不仅能获得系统更新,更能解锁隐藏性能。这个开源工具就像给旧设备装上了"新引擎",让它们在数字时代继续发挥价值!💻✨
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考